What are the fees associated with trading cryptocurrencies on Vantage Canada?

Can you provide a detailed explanation of the fees associated with trading cryptocurrencies on Vantage Canada? I would like to know the different types of fees, such as trading fees, deposit fees, withdrawal fees, and any other fees that may be applicable. Additionally, it would be helpful to understand how these fees are calculated and if there are any discounts or promotions available.

- May 03, 2022 · 3 years agoAs an expert in the field, I can provide you with a comprehensive overview of the fees associated with trading cryptocurrencies on Vantage Canada. Firstly, there are trading fees, which are charged for each trade you execute. These fees are typically a percentage of the trade value and can vary depending on the specific cryptocurrency pair you are trading. Additionally, there may be deposit fees when you fund your account with cryptocurrencies or fiat currencies. The deposit fees can vary depending on the deposit method you choose, such as bank transfer or credit card. Similarly, withdrawal fees may apply when you want to transfer your funds from Vantage Canada to an external wallet or bank account. The withdrawal fees can also vary depending on the cryptocurrency and the withdrawal method selected. It's worth noting that Vantage Canada occasionally offers promotional discounts on trading fees, so it's advisable to check their website or contact their customer support for the latest information on fees and any available promotions.
